Passed light brown tissue in stool during abdominal pain

I'm 23 yrs old and for about a week I've had pain on my left side varying from mild to severe with extreme constipation. I was having diarrhea before the pain started, so I took an immodium. My doctor said he's pretty sure it's colitis, since the pain gets worse after I eat with gradual improvement if I don't eat for a while. I'm still having the same pain, but I just started having small, firm bowel movements. All of this was fine, but today I passed some kind of light brown tissue. I'm fairly sure it's not mucus, and certain it's not bloody at all. Very confused. It just didn't feel right. Any thoughts?
